Deploying to Windows Server 2008 (IIS 7)

IIS Integrated Mode (IIS 7.x for Windows Server 2008)

When a web site is running under the IIS Integrated Mode, the web server searches the HttpHandler registrations under the <system.webServer> configuration section instead of the standard <system.web> configuration section of the application configuration file. It may be needed to manually register the AspMap image handler, or using the IIS administration capabilities.


The manual registration is done the following way. Suppose you have the following structure of the web.config file:


<add path="MapImageHandler.axd" verb="*" type="AspMap.Web.ImageHandler, AspMapNET" /> 

To manually register the HttpHandler for the IIS 7 Integrated Mode, copy the AspMap.Web.ImageHandler to the <handlers> section of the <system.webServer> section group, and give it a name:

<add name="AspMap.Web.ImageHandler" path="MapImageHandler.axd" verb="*" type="AspMap.Web.ImageHandler, AspMapNET" preCondition="integratedMode" />
<validation validateIntegratedModeConfiguration="false" />


